

11 o'clock Worship Service  After the various Sabbath School divisions finished their programs, the young children joined with the adults in the main auditorium for the worship service. There was much singing and music, a lot of prayer - including a season of prayer, and a message of boldness.
The Sacramento-Capitol City Church Praise Team started the main worship service with song service, just as they had done for the adult Sabbath School.

Pedro Trinidad, pastor of the Concord and Lodi Spanish churches, performed one special music selection for the church service (below) and the Orangevale School Girls' Choir gave both the offertory and another special music selection (above).

There was a special section of seats for those in need of a sign language translator. Various translators assisted throughout the day's program.

J. Kendall Guy (center), pastor of the Oakland-Market Street church, facilitated a season of prayer and invited all in attendance to pray together in pairs or small groups.

Jim Pedersen, NCC president, delivered the morning's message and challenged the members of the NCC to act in boldness for God. |
